It pains me i never played for Barcelona and Madrid - Pirlo












Andrea Pirlo has admitted he regrets neve playing for either Barcelona or Real Madrid in his career. The player revealed this to Marca.

Pirlo who transferred to New York City FC in July 2015, said he was approached by both the Spanish top clubs during his time at AC Milan but the Italian club would not allow him to leave.

Pirlo said: "I still have a thorn in my side at not
having played for Real Madrid or Barcelona, because playing there is a dream for every player.

"But I consider myself very satisfied to have played for the best teams in Italy."

In 2006, Real Madrid under management of Fabio Capell approached Pirlo but a transfer did not fall through. The season AC Milan received a points deduction after being implicated in a match-fixing
scandal.

"Real Madrid? Any player would like to play for
them," Pirlo said. "Fabio Capello was there and
there were a lot of rumours circulating about
Milan's future because of the scandal.

"Milan wouldn't let me go, and they gave me a
new contract. Was I disappointed? Well it's true
that unfortunately they wouldn't let me leave,
but at the same time I spent 10 years at Milan,
winning everything there was to win."

Barcelona also  tried to sign Pirlo for Barcelona in 2010 but again, Milan turned down his approach.

Pirlo said he had been tempted, adding: "How
could you not want to go there? Guardiola told
me he wanted me in his team."

He left the San Siro a year later, joining Juventus on a three-year contract and going on to win four straight Serie A titles.

"I needed another team with a new project, but still a winning one," he said.

"Juve were perfect, as they hadn't won in a long time and were making their debut in their new stadium. It was the best place to start building."
